Kaishi Kokusai High School
Kaishi Kokusai High School is a school in Tainai Shi, Niigata.Places of Interest Nearby

Nakajō Station is a railway station on the Uetsu Main Line in the city of Tainai, Niigata, Japan, operated by East Japan Railway Company. Nakajo is situated 1½ km north of Kaishi Kokusai High School.

Kanazuka Station is a railway station in the city of Shibata, Niigata, Japan, operated by East Japan Railway Company. Kanazuka Station is situated 2½ km southwest of Kaishi Kokusai High School.
